About this route:
A direct, nonstop flight between Nyurba Airport (NYR), Nyurba, Sakha Republic, Russia and Alta Airport (ALF), Alta, Norway would travel a Great Circle distance of 2,371 miles (or 3,815 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Facts about Alta Airport (ALF):
- In addition to being known as "Alta Airport", another name for ALF is "Alta lufthavn".
- The airport is served by Norwegian Air Shuttle and Scandinavian Airlines with Boeing 737 aircraft on flights to Tromsø and Oslo.
- The closest airport to Alta Airport (ALF) is Lakselv Airport, Banak (LKL), which is located 38 miles (62 kilometers) E of ALF.
- Alta Airport is an international airport serving Alta, a town and municipality in Finnmark county, Norway.
- Services were at first operated by Scandinavian Airlines System.
- The furthest airport from Alta Airport (ALF) is Chatham Islands (CHT), which is located 10,502 miles (16,901 kilometers) away in Waitangi, Chatham Islands, New Zealand.
- The airport is located at Elvebakken and Altagård, on the southern shore of the Altafjord and at the mouth of the river of Altaelva, which is about 4 kilometers east of Bossekop in the town of Alta.
- Alta Airport handled 353,051 passengers last year.
- Alta Airport (ALF) currently has only 1 runway.
- The first airport in Alta was built by the Wehrmacht during the German occupation of Norway.
- Because of Alta Airport's relatively low elevation of 10 feet, planes can take off or land at Alta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
